MAIL NOTICES
NEW PLYMOUTH. Mails will close (subject to alteration) at the Chief Post Office, New Plymouth, as follows: For Wellington and South, also for Auckland and North, daily, per Mail Train, at 0.15 a.m. • THURSDAY, AUGUST 18. For Australian States (due Sydney August 23), United Kingdom and Continent of Europe, via Brindisi (due London September 26), at 6.15 a.m. For Auckland and North, per Earawa, at 7 p.m. SATURDAY, AUGUST 20.
For Australian States (due Sydney August 26), also Sout' Africa (due Capetown September 2l\ s,t 6.15 a.m.
The next parcel mail for the United Kingdom closes here on Tuesday, August 23, at 5 p.m. The next mail for the United Kingdom and Canada closes hr/re on Tuesday, 30th inst., at (J. 13 ajn. (fia Vancouver).
Late fee letters for South may he posted in the mail van of xiutward express, and in the guard's van of other passenger trains up to time of departure. Late-fee letters for Auckland and North may be posted in the late-feo receiving box, at the Chief Post Office up to 7.30 on Auckland mail nights, and in the late-fee box at the railway station up to arrival of inward express. W. J, OHANEY, Chief Postmaster.
